The postcode TN11 0WD is located in Tonbridge and Malling, in the county of Kent. It was introduced in May 2004 and terminated in July 2005.TN11 0WD is a large user postcode, usually allocated to a single address receiving at least 500 mail items per day.
TN11 0WD is one of the least de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 7.7 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of TN11 0WD as Urbanites > Urban professionals and families > White professionals.
The closest road name to TN11 0WD is Mill View which is centered 57 m away.
The nearest bus stop is College and is 604 m away. The closest railway station is Tonbridge Rail Station, 5.84 km away.
The closest primary school to TN11 0WD (for ages 11 and under) is Hadlow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on October 2, 2019.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Hugh Christie School. The last OFSTED inspection on December 6, 2017 rated this school as Good
The local pub for residents of TN11 0WD is Rose And Crown and is 116 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Good on October 22, 2019.
Policing for TN11 0WD is covered by the Kent police force association and West Kent is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
